Seattle Children’s Hospital Research Assistant in Seattle, Washington

Responsibilities: Researchers at Seattle Children's are looking for individuals to assist with data collection for studies about physical activity. Individuals will be trained in two different observational data collection methods and primarily assist the research team with data collection offsite by observing schoolyards at middle and elementary schools around Tacoma and/or Seattle, WA. Data collection occurs on weekdays and weekends throughout April and on weekdays in May 2024. Individuals located near Tacoma are strongly encouraged to apply. There may be opportunities to get involved in other aspects of research. Requirements: Required Education/Experience: - High school diploma or equivalent. - Two (2) years of college-level coursework in biological or life sciences or health related field. - At least one (1) year of work experience. - Per the driver's license requirement noted below, must have a driving record acceptable to Risk Management. Required Credentials: - Any position that requires the use of a motor vehicle will require a current Washington State Driver's license. Preferred: - Bachelor's degree in biological or life sciences or health related field. - At least three (3) years in a research or health care setting. - Familiarity with US Food & Drug Administration (FDA) regulations and International Conference on Harmonization (ICH) and Good Clinical Practice (GCP) guidelines. - Knowledge of medical terminology. Min to Max Hourly Salary: $20.50 - $30.76 /hr Min to Max Annual Salary: $42,640.00 - $63,980.80 /yr Salary Information: This compensation range was calculated based on full-time employment (2080 hours worked per calendar year). Offers are determined by multiple factors including equity, skills, experience, and expertise, and may vary within the range provided.
